Minecart Madness, released in 2022, is a thrilling 2D arcade infinite-runner that takes inspiration from the classic platforming games of yesteryear. Players take control of a minecart, expertly jumping over a variety of fast-approaching obstacles to achieve the highest score possible. Its retro graphics and fast-paced gameplay offer a nostalgic yet refreshing experience for fans of action and indie games.
